C004997 — Cyber Security Engineer

Location: The Hague, Netherlands
Working arrangement: Full-time, primarily on-site; limited remote work may be approved
Security clearance: NATO Secret
Environment: Normal office environment

Main duties

  • Design security-compliant architectures for AirC2 and related mission-support systems.
  • Document key architectural decisions and define cloud or on-premises components, interfaces, and technical specifications.
  • Ensure solutions comply with enterprise, solution architecture, and security standards.
  • Configure, test, integrate, and troubleshoot security products and services.
  • Integrate local security services with central security infrastructure or provide equivalent local controls.
  • Implement and maintain security controls based on policy and risk assessments.
  • Identify, assess, communicate, and mitigate technical and information-security risks.
  • Define secure system configurations and support investigations into suspected attacks or breaches.
  • Conduct information-assurance assessments and provide routine accreditation support.
  • Prepare and maintain risk assessments, risk-treatment plans, and decision records.
  • Define, document, prioritise, trace, and manage requirements for small changes and support complex initiatives.
  • Review requirements for errors or omissions and manage authorised changes to baselined requirements.
  • Work with stakeholders to resolve conflicts and agree priorities.
  • Escalate decisions that fall outside the role’s authority.
  • Perform other security-related duties as required.

Essential requirements

  • Education and experience:
    • BSc from a recognised university in a technical subject with substantial IT content, plus at least three years of relevant experience; or
    • At least five years of extensive and progressive relevant experience if no degree is held.
  • At least three years’ knowledge and experience in:
    • Security monitoring
    • Public Key Infrastructure (PKI)
    • Vulnerability management
    • Identity and access management
    • Research and evaluation of security products and technologies
    • UNIX and Windows system and network administration
    • System and network security, particularly Zero-Trust and Data-Centric architectures
  • Ability to:
    • Evaluate risks and develop mitigation plans
    • Produce clear, structured technical reports in English for technical and executive audiences
    • Present technical briefings verbally in English

Desirable requirements

  • Experience working in an international environment involving military and civilian personnel.
  • Knowledge of NATO’s organisation, internal structure, and working relationships.
